description Pembroke Castle Overview

Pembroke Castle is a medieval fortress in southwest Wales, notable as the birthplace of Henry VII in 1457 and for its massive round keep.

help Pembroke Castle FAQ

Was Henry VII born at Pembroke Castle?

Yes, Henry VII was born at Pembroke Castle in 1457. That Tudor connection is one of the castle's most famous historical claims.

What is distinctive about Pembroke Castle's keep?

Pembroke Castle is known for its massive round keep. The keep is one of the strongest visual features of the medieval fortress in southwest Wales.

Where is Pembroke Castle located?

Pembroke Castle is in Pembroke, in southwest Wales. Its position near the water helped make it an important Norman and medieval stronghold.

Who is Pembroke Castle most associated with besides Henry VII?

The castle is strongly associated with Anglo-Norman power in Wales and with the earls of Pembroke. Its fame today often centers on Henry VII's 1457 birth there.
